Hey — passing the Parcelwire tracking webhook to you for review. Quick context: carriers push status events to our receiver, we verify signatures, then fan out to Cartogram downstream. Signature validation is HMAC-based and rotates quarterly; replay protection uses a 5-minute timestamp window, which you'll probably want to scrutinize. Retries are at-least-once, so the dedupe table matters. One known wart: staging skips signature checks. The receiver boots from the configuration values listed right below this note.

service settings:
[silwyn]
host = silwyn.crelvogrid.internal
user = silwyn_svc
database = silwyn_prod

## Limits and Quotas — Sprigly Scheduler

Sprigly enforces per-household caps on watering jobs to keep the valve controllers from overlapping cycles. Exceeding the daily job quota silently defers tasks to the next window, so release notes must mention any changes here. Confirm the staging soak test passed before shipping. The enforced limits are defined in the block below.

constants for hahaf-fawif:
RATE_LIMITS = {
    "holir": 5,
    "ruswyn": 499,
    "istion": 753,
}

### Step 4: Export memory limits

Gridleaf's spreadsheet export now streams rows instead of buffering whole workbooks. Large exports that previously failed with out-of-memory errors should complete, but per-worker memory caps changed. Support: if a customer's export stalls above 200k rows, verify their tenant inherited the new limits. The post-migration defaults applied to every tenant are as follows.

deployment values, yadug-bawif:
[framir]
team = pelox
access_code = ac_a38ab2
owner = tamion.julael
host = framir.tolvaqlabs.test
port = 11211
peer = tammir.zemvargrid.local
salt = 2215ef03
pin = 1541